Compare the rivalry schools - Shorter University and University of Georgia.

Shorter University is a Private, 4-years school located in Rome, GA and University of Georgia (UGA) is a Public, 4-years school located in Athens, GA. Following list and table compares two rivalry schools in various academic factors.
  • University of Georgia has higher submitted SAT score (1,310) than Shorter University (1,070).
  • University of Georgia (42.55% acceptance rate) is tighter than Shorter University (97.47% acceptance rate) to get in.
  • University of Georgia (40,607 students) is larger than Shorter University (1,515 students).
  • University of Georgia has more expensive tuition & fees of $30,220 than Shorter University($24,044).
  • University of Georgia has more full-time faculties of 2,140 faculties than Shorter University(72 facluties).
